Elastic for Sewing

Next time you need elastic for that sewing project but don't have any on hand, just grab the old panty hose or knee highs and cut the band off the top. Makes great elastic! And it's free!

For about 30 years I've used the elastic from worn out support hose to go in the top of slacks I've made. They out last the slacks. Sometimes I take it out of worn out slacks and put it in new slacks.

I haven't bought elastic in 30 years. If I donate slacks I don't like, I take the elastic out.
